Samson Tractor Company

Samson Tractor Company war ein US-amerikanisches Unternehmen, das Ackerschlepper von 1900 bis 1923 sowie Lastkraftwagen von 1920 bis 1923 herstellte. Ein 1919 geplanter Personenkraftwagen ging nicht in die Produktion. Zeitweilig gehörte die Marke zum General-Motors-Konzern. .. weiterlesen
